Review of Dunsley Highlander 5 stove

Dunsley Highlander 5 Environburn - amazing!

Joanna Nunn 8 years ago

This stove has proved why it has such good reviews - it's so economical and you can burn it at the rate you want - ticking over or roaring. It's so quiet and efficient - you wonder if it's on!

With both controls closed it still outputs good heat. However, you do need to read the instruction book to get the best out of lighting and controlling the burn.

We chose the Environburn Model with the Solo door and higher legs - it's great looking and sleek.

It has a clear ceramic door and you must not clean this with water or it will get a crackled glaze look. Leave the airwash slightly open to clean the door - the black soot will clear to view flames.

The handle does get hot but it is easy to open and close.

The firebox is big enough for three good sized logs, which will burn for two or three hours.

Use dry kindling wood to start it as it can smoke with wet or green wood.

It's easy to clean and remove the ashes.

We had it installed by a local fitter who took the hassle out of getting the stove and installing it - and provided a beautiful granite hearth - all at a competitive price. The installation was trickier than expected and there were a couple of hiccups but the installer sorted it out quickly. We were impressed with the follow up service and response.

All in all - a great start to the winter - exceeding our expectations.
